About Zhamak Khorgami

Zhamak Khorgami is a scholar working on Surgery, Pharmacy and Internal Medicine, having authored 102 papers that have together received 2.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bariatric Surgery and Outcomes (42 papers), Body Contouring and Surgery (13 papers) and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(12 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Surgery (1.6k citations), Pharmacy (173 citations) and Internal Medicine (102 citations). Zhamak Khorgami has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Iran and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Ali Aminian, Stacy A. Brethauer, Philip R. Schauer, Saeed Shoar, Amin Andalib, Abolfazl Shojaiefard, Bagher Larijani, Guido M. Sclabas, C. Anthony Howard and Theresa Jackson.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Annals of Surgery and Transplantation.
